Nevertheless, delinquency rates are still near historical lows. The average delinquency rate because the Fed began tracking in 1991 is 3.69%, while the average because 2000 is 3.43%. Current delinquency rates likewise stay well listed below Terrific Recession levels, when they peaked at nearly 7% in 2009 and remained above 5% for practically two years.

A brand-new report from The Century Structure (TCF) and Secure Borrowers reveals the shocking effect of President Donald Trump's affordability crisis on Americans' finances, as an analysis of consumer credit information shows that approximately half of active cardholders and 40 percent of U.S. grownups are not able to pay their credit card expenses in full and carry a balance from month to month.

Of that group, more than 27 million Americans can only afford the minimum payment each month. The report in addition finds that Americans have paid a record-setting amount of interest as a result of credit card banks doubling their profit margins over the last twenty years. Americans have paid a cumulative total of $2.1 trillion in charge card interest because 2010, which is more than the overall amount of outstanding trainee debt, and the overall quantity of vehicle loan financial obligation, owed at the end of 2025.
